The Chosen Ones | Joe Smith



It’s easy to look at God and wonder if he’s holding out on us. With so much going on we can feel overlooked. It’s important to remember that the power of faithfulness is in the day-to-day moments.

The story of David is a great reminder, that we are all chosen by God, maybe just not right now in the way we want. You have been chosen by God to do a powerful thing, but you must be faithful with what you’ve been given now so that you can be trusted later.

Out of 1 Samuel 17:17-19 Pastor Joe Smith tells us about the story of David. David was teaching us how faithfulness is an important aspect of who we become.  He reminds us it’s not who you are when you get what you want, it’s who you are when you could be doing other things but you choose to do the hard things. God wants to teach us to serve but our heart posture must be right. We can elevate our roles by taking responsibility, not so we can think more highly of ourselves, but so we can serve others.

God used David’s faithfulness to bring him to greatness. The thing that positions us most powerfully, is our commitment to faithfulness. David is a great example of living a life where nothing is beneath you.

“The path towards your greatest future will always be paved by your service.”

–Joe Smith

A Conversation With Kelly Rowland & Erwin McManus



Kelly Rowland joined our Lead Pastor Erwin McManus for a conversation that offered such incredible insight. Pastor Erwin asked Kelly about her journey with her career and family, and how race and faith have impacted her story. Kelly empowered us to live a generous life and expect to see how God moves through our generosity.

When they covered Kelly’s career, she emphasized the importance of truly loving your work. Our dreams are meant to bring us enjoyment, even when the journey seems difficult along the way. There is a grit that is required to step into the dreams God has given us, and hard work can take us places that talent never could.

Pastor Erwin asked Kelly to share her passion for giving. She told a story of a time when she felt stuck. Her best friend encouraged her to give and be generous, and to see how God would provide. Kelly made bold decisions after that conversation and decided to be more and more generous. She saw how God showed up for her again and again when she surrendered through generosity.

Kelly then shared a moment of feeling fear when she found out she was going to be having a son. But, she was reminded that God would give her what she needed to raise a black man in today’s society. She also encouraged single women to look for a husband who is kind, a good communicator, and clear on his faith.

“It’s not about your desire for the outcome, it’s about your love for the process.”

–Erwin McManus
